Transaction 0e661202d7998dc7e1d59233a328b74fa26a81430cec53de5f5e27bbbc7624cf
1 Input
1 Output
-
0e661202d7998dc7e1d59233a328b74fa26a81430cec53de5f5e27bbbc7624cf:0
- value
- 117572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62bce9a856ef87fa985c1fd83d74501c926a4d57 OP_EQUAL
- address
- 3Ah6TEFsEscfyLjtQDStYgAAcTMEHaNxoB